Probably just a perception thing on my part - ive had a look at a couple of each recently and the 200s just seemed a little more 'solid' could well be down to the individual cars i guess.



You'd think age alone: 2006 for early 197's to 2012 for the the last of the 200's could validate that point alone......

Not just about mileage is it. People talk about (these) engines being good for 150'000+ miles; but what about joint wear, corrosion, suspension being past its best, bushes perishing over time, things degrading, hoses cracking, rubber breaking down etc etc etc

Not to mention the fact Renault MAY just have learnt one or two things about model specific assembly along the way.

Good luck on finding a Clio. Buyers market at the minute, there are loads of cars available and for really affordable money. Take your time and be meticulous and you'll find a good one. If it's more a track focused car, maybe keep an eye on the classifieds on here. Some very tasty cars come up from time to time. Depends on how much of a road car you need it to be. For instance @BenAG200 has a bloody awesome track car that might be available right now.

As for the quality perception, I think it is just that, a perception. I've been in some nice solid 197s and been in some sketchy 200s too. Just down to the life and the type of ownership the car has had I guess.
